The Sanford Pentagon is collaborating with the South Dakota Basketball Coaches Association to host a virtual fall coach’s clinic on Saturday, Nov. 14.
The event will run from 9 a.m. to 1 p.m. and is free to members of the association. Information for the Zoom invite and registration process will be sent to members.
Featured speakers and topics include:
David Moe-Head Women’s Coach Dakota State University
Topic: 2-3 Zone Concepts
Linda Sayavongchanh- Assistant Women’s Basketball Creighton University
Topic: Recruiting
Todd Schlimgen- Mount Marty Head Women’s Coach
Topic: Dribble Drive Offensive Concepts
Dawn Seiler- Aberdeen Central High School Head Girl’s Coach
Topic: Blocker Motion Offense
Paul Raasch- Langford High School Head Boy’s Coach
Topic: Practice Plans/Favorite Drills/Man to Man Sets
Reid Ouse- Youth, International, College and Professional Trainer
Topic: How We Consume Basketball Content-Social Media-Understanding Purpose and Content
Bill Vincent/Jamie Granum- Sioux Valley Basketball
Topic: Competitive Practice Drills
Shane Hennen- Director of the Pentagon Basketball Academy
Topic: Short Sided Games for Development/Finish and Footwork Warmups
